Maintenance measures
Cleaning the front
of the machine
Cleaning the
wash cabinet
Cleaning the door
seal
78
The stainless steel front should only be cleaned with a damp cloth
and a cleaning and disinfecting agent or with a non-abrasive stain-
less steel cleaner.
To help prevent resoiling (fingerprints, etc.), a suitable stainless steel
conditioner can be used after cleaning.
Do not use cleaning agents containing ammonia or thinners!
These agents can damage the surface material.
 Risk of fire due to ingress of water.
The pressure of a water jet can cause water to get into the ma-
chine.
Never clean the machine or near vicinity with a water hose or a
pressure washer.
The wash cabinet is mostly self-cleaning.
However, if you notice a build-up of deposits, please contact Miele
Technical Service for advice.
The door seal should be cleaned regularly with a damp cloth to re-
move any soiling.
Seals which are no longer tight or which have suffered damage
must be replaced with new ones by Miele Technical Service.
